Disregarding the Surrounding Atmosphere
When choosing exterior paint colors, numerous companies overlook the value of their surrounding atmosphere, which can cause mismatched aesthetic appeals and lost possibilities. You might discover a lively shade appealing in isolation, yet if it clashes with nearby frameworks or the all-natural landscape, it can develop an inhospitable atmosphere.
Consider the building design of bordering structures and the general ambiance of your area. If you're in a coastal community, soft blues and sandy off-whites may reverberate far better than bold reds or deep environment-friendlies. Also, city setups usually prefer sleek, modern palettes that line up with the surrounding framework.
Take time to examine the shades dominating your neighborhood. This doesn't suggest you can not express your brand's individuality, however it ought to harmonize with its atmosphere. You wish to bring in customers, not repel them with jarring contrasts.
Integrating elements like regional vegetation can additionally boost your design, developing a smooth shift between your organization and its surroundings.
Overlooking Color Psychology
Disregarding the surrounding environment can bring about mismatched visual appeals, but that's simply one part of the formula. You can't overlook shade psychology when picking exterior paint colors for your business. Colors stimulate feelings and can greatly influence exactly how potential customers regard your brand name. For instance, blue typically conveys count on and expertise, while red can ignite passion and seriousness.
Consider your target audience and the feelings you want to stimulate. If your organization is family-oriented, cozy shades like yellows and oranges can create an inviting environment. Conversely, if you're aiming for a streamlined, modern-day vibe, great tones like gray or navy may be more appropriate.
Don't fail to remember that colors can likewise impact presence and attract attention. Brighter hues can stand out in a jampacked environment, making your service extra visible. Nonetheless, pick sensibly; excessively brilliant colors may overwhelm or hinder clients, depending upon your market.
Ensure to check paint samples in various lighting problems to see just how they connect with the environment and your message.

Neglecting Upkeep Requirements
Choosing the right outside paint color isn't almost aesthetic appeals or brand alignment; it also includes considering upkeep. When you select a shade, consider how it will stand up in time and what upkeep it'll demand. Some shades reveal dirt and grime greater than others, requiring constant cleansing or re painting . For example, lighter colors might need normal cleaning to keep them looking fresh, while darker tones could fade quicker under severe sunlight.
Don't fail to remember to assess the paint's resilience versus the components. If you remain in an area with severe weather condition, opt for a color and finish that holds up against the conditions. Particular colors can additionally reflect warm or absorb it, affecting your structure's energy performance and longevity.
Additionally, take into consideration just how typically you want to invest time and money into upkeep. If you favor a low-maintenance alternative, select a color that's much less susceptible to fading or discoloration.
Inevitably, making an enlightened option regarding paint colors indicates factoring in the long-term maintenance, guaranteeing your organization looks its best without constant intervention. Maintain these maintenance needs in mind to stay clear of expensive repairs and ensure your exterior remains enticing gradually.
Avoiding Test Examples
While it could seem tempting to avoid the test examples when picking exterior paint colors, doing so can bring about unexpected outcomes. You could believe you have actually picked the best color based on a tiny example or an electronic sneak peek, but shades can look significantly different depending upon lighting and environments.
What feels like a vivid blue in the shop might appear plain or washed out on your building. To avoid this error, constantly test your chosen shades on the actual surface. Purchase small sample pots and use spots on various locations of your outside.
Observe how the shade changes throughout the day as the light shifts. This easy action can conserve you from a costly repaint later. Additionally, think about the shades of bordering buildings and landscape design. These components can affect just how your shade option looks in the more comprehensive context.
Do not fail to remember to take note of the coating-- matte, satin, or glossy-- considering that it also impacts the overall look. Spending time in screening examples ensures you're not just completely satisfied with the shade but likewise positive it enhances your business's visual allure.
